Sorry to revive this post. I'm interested in trailing a car with my X3 M40i.

Are there any updates on fitting either a factory towbar or aftermarket one that is suitable for trailing a car?

Keen to understand costs and recommendations in the UK only.

Thxs in advance.
What sort of weight are you towing? The retrofit towbars inc BMWs have a max load of 2000kg tow weight but a factory fitted one the load rating of the vehicle is increased to 2400kg.

Not sure if Westfalia do dedicated electrics for the X3 yet but they didn't in 2019 when i was looking. The official removable towbar though is made by Westfalia and that's what I went for with their electrics on my F11 a few years ago. I wouldn't fit any other no brand dedicated electrics and don't go with a bypass relay as the car wont realise you have a trailer attached (it changes shift points, DSC parameters etc with a trailer on).
